The most seen church in France, dedicated to Mayol, with a miraculous fountain, in the ascent, which gives sight to a blind man.

Without doubt the most seen Romanesque church in France. Indeed, all motorists who take the A7 motorway have been able to admire this church, which is part of the Cluny Order movement. It was around 960 that a small community of Benedictine monks settled in Ternay under the patronage of Mayeul. The construction of the church will not begin until the second half of the eleventh century. A church dedicated to Mayol, abbot of Cluny, a character whose legend relates that he made a miraculous fountain spring up, on the left in the Saint-Mayol rise, giving sight to a blind man.
